Why Do Coffee Beans Need to be Cooled Down?


Roasting coffee beans is a process that transforms coffee beans into the aromatic, flavorful product we all enjoy. While roasting is the most well-known part of the process, one critical step that often goes unnoticed is the cooling phase immediately after roasting

Cooling roasted coffee beans is not just about bringing down the temperature; it’s an essential process that impacts the quality, flavor, and shelf life of the coffee. It is also a way to prevent "carry-over cooking," where the internal heat continues to alter the beans' chemical and physical structure. Without rapid cooling, this can lead to overdeveloped roast profiles, diminishing the flavors of the coffee

What is the Most Effective Way to Cool Down Roasted Coffee Beans?
Air cooling is the most common and cost-effective method for cooling roasted coffee, but ambient temperature plays a significant role in the process. Roasters must monitor their environment, especially in extreme climates or high altitudes, as variations can prolong cooling

On the other hand, there’s a method called “Quenching”, where roasted coffee beans are sprayed with water to lower its temperature, particularly in large batches and darker roasts. This method can cause the beans to reabsorb water, that’s why it’s less favored among the methods

Effects of Delaying the Coffee Cooling Process
Delayed cooling can lead to overdevelopment, causing unwanted bitterness and harshness, while reducing fruity notes and sweetness. This happens as the beans retain excess heat, leading to more oils on the surface and making sugars less soluble, resulting in a flatter flavor profile

How Long Should Roasters Cool Down Their Coffee?
While many roasters agree on a four-minute cooling window, the cooling process for roasted coffee typically takes about 3 to 5 minutes. Although, factors like room temperature, bean age, and density can influence the cooling rate. Faster cooling generally leads to greater sweetness and improved cup quality. Using air or fan cooling is the most common method, which ensures that the beans cool rapidly and consistently

In conclusion, the cooling process after roasting is crucial for halting further cooking and preserving the unique flavors of the beans.
